South Jersey Times

The South Jersey Times is a regional newspaper dedicated to the South Jersey community in New Jersey. It was established on November 4, 2012, after the merger of three related publications: Gloucester County Times, The News of Cumberland County, and Today's Sunbeam of Salem, which all stopped printing after November 3. Initially, the newspaper concentrated on reporting news from Camden, Cumberland, Gloucester, and Salem counties, but it later broadened its scope to include the entire South Jersey region. The South Jersey Times retained the staff from its predecessor papers and launched with an initial subscriber count of 30,000. It is also affiliated with NJ.com.

  • 21 hours ago | nj.com | Katie Kausch

    Beautiful beaches, miles of highways and a Wawa on every corner. Sounds like it could be New Jersey — but you’re more likely to see all those Wawas in Florida now that new data show the Sunshine State has surpassed both New Jersey and Pennsylvania as the Wawa capital of the world. There were 304 Wawas in Florida as of May 6, surpassing New Jersey’s 293 locations, according to data aggregator ScrapeHero. More than a quarter of all Wawas are in Florida now.
